Biography

Viktor Sergeevitsj Birkenberg was a talented Soviet architect who contributed to the built environment during the early Soviet period. His architectural work reflected the aesthetic and ideological currents of his time.

He was executed at the Kommunarka shooting ground in 1938 during the Great Purge, a devastating period that claimed many creative professionals and intellectuals.
